American Power Act Endorses Expansion of Clean Transportation Options

Transportation for America, the largest, most diverse coalition working on transportation reform, expressed support for key provisions of the Kerry-Lieberman American Power Act as a major endorsement of clean transportation options to spur energy independence and climate protection.

Kerry-Lieberman Proposal Major Step Forward for Clean Transportation

The American Power Act was released today, and T4 released this statement: “The Kerry-Lieberman American Power Act is a major endorsement of clean transportation as a critical strategy for energy independence and climate protection. The authors deserve high praise for ensuring that revenues generated from the transportation sector go in part toward meeting the growing demand for more, better and cleaner travel options.”
